Chapter 1016

Grace let out a cold snort and sat down on the sofa with bold defiance. โ€œMy patience is limited. Youโ€™d better go get him out here now. As for trespassing, youโ€™re welcome to call the police. Iโ€™ll gladly deal with them.โ€

Grace had never been afraid of confrontation, but she didnโ€™t seek it either. But now that these people had pushed her to the edge, how could she possibly stay quiet? She had only two precious daughters, and both had been hurt by their son. Did they really think they could just play dumb and walk away unscathed? Their son might be out of his mind, but they still had a father and a mother.

And behind them, a family and a corporation. None of this was make-believe. They were all adults, and sooner or later, theyโ€™d have to pay for their actions. Sitting here doing nothing and refusing to acknowledge the truth wouldnโ€™t lead anywhere good.

Carol stood frozen, trembling where she was, unsure of what to do in the face of Graceโ€™s dominance. She was nothing more than a pampered lite who had never dealt with the business world, let alone involved herself in any commercial dealings. She knew full well that if she tried to interfere, Albert would only grow suspicious. So, it was better to remain on the sidelines. That was exactly why Graceโ€™s aura overwhelmed hers completely. They werenโ€™t even operating on the same level.

โ€œI really donโ€™t know anythingโ€ฆ Thereโ€™s no point pressuring me like thisโ€ฆโ€ Carol used every ounce of strength she had just to get that full sentence out. โ€œIโ€™m just a woman whoโ€™s never touched business. Even if you question me to death, I wonโ€™t have any answers.โ€

Grace finally understood โ€“ Carol was ready to throw in the towel. Either way, it wasnโ€™t going to affect her. Driving her away would simplify everything. Grace crossed her arms and sneered, scanning her from head to toe. โ€œAre you sure you still want to keep pretending?โ€

Carolโ€™s eyes flickered as she feigned ignorance. โ€œI told you, I donโ€™t know anything.โ€ That was exactly the plan in her mind. As long as they couldnโ€™t find Albert, Grace and her people would probably leave. And truthfully, she didnโ€™t know anything anyway. Besides, they were looking for Albertโ€”what was the point of making things hard for her?

At that moment, Albert was upstairs secretly observing everything. He had also kept Julian close by, afraid he might suddenly run downstairs and mess things up. He and Carol shared the same thought. If they couldnโ€™t find him, Grace and her entourage would likely leave. He was completely cornered now, with no other option but to hide. Albert was surviving in the cracks.

Already overwhelmed with anxiety, he turned his head and saw his son crouched on the floor like a fool, fiddling with something unknown. Frustration surged within him, and he kicked Julian without warning, growling in a low voice, โ€œAll you do is play with useless crap. Just like you โ€“ completely useless.โ€

Julian didnโ€™t respond after being kicked. His gaze darkened, long bangs falling over his eyes, perfectly concealing the vicious glint within them. Albert had always been like this โ€“ insisting he was never wrong, placing the blame on everyone else. He didnโ€™t necessarily fight others head-on, but he always made sure to shift all responsibility away from himself.
